How to Hide Files using Dialer on Android Smartphones:

  1. Firstly, you need to install the app named as “Dialer Vault – VaultDroid Hide Photo Video OS 10” or “zDialer”. From the Play Store or you can also click the below button for direct download. This app works as your personal vault, It hides pictures, songs, videos, apps, files, and more. [appbox googleplay com.dialervault.dialerhidephoto]
  2. After installation, you need to open the app and skip the start tutorial. Give the app permissions to the Dialer Vault by accepting all permissions.
  3. Now set the default password by dialing a secret code in the dialer and click on the call button. You need to enter the secret code or PIN to hide your files. Enter your PIN and here to see a lot of options to hide pictures, songs, videos, apps, files, and more. Click on the option according to your file extension and select the file you want to hide.
  4. After selecting the file, the app shows that your file is safely hidden in Dialer.
  5. For accessing the hidden file, you need to open the Dialer Vault app and enter your PIN. Now you will the options in which your file is hidden, open it and here you can access your app.
